Seino Jongkees is an Associate Professor at Vrije Universiteit Amsterdam, focusing on the interface of chemical biology and biotechnology. He has a solid background in biochemistry and extensive experience in research related to molecular discovery and the development of fungal hit discovery platforms. His current research projects include targeting lipoprotein processing enzymes in Gram-negative pathogens and various datasets related to peptide library sequencing for influenza and SARS-CoV-2 studies. Jongkees co-founded VirXcel and Stealth Biotech, demonstrating his commitment to applying research insights in practical biotechnology applications. He actively supervises student internships and is dedicated to advancing knowledge in chemical biology through teaching and research initiatives.
